Cody Carr's Hunting Adventures operates in northwest Montana's prime big game country—what Cody calls God's Country. Born and raised in an outfitting family, Carr brings generational experience to every hunt. His operation is licensed through Montana (License #8313) and handles both archery and rifle hunts across multiple species.
"Cody will tailor your hunt to fit your goals and ability. That can mean spending your night's miles deep in the wilderness in a spike camp, or coming back to the lodge to a warm bed every night." — Dan Vastyan, PA
Cody and his guides scout and shed hunt year-round—not just before season. They know the territories, understand animal patterns, and prepare specifically for your hunt. Accommodations range from remote spike camps to the main lodge with full meals. Multiple repeat hunters reference success rates of 2-3 harvests per 3 hunts.
The operation maintains detailed harvest reports dating back to 2006. Recent trophies include a 6'11" bear and consistent elk and deer harvests. Photo galleries and video documentation show animals taken across multiple seasons.
Hunts include professional guides, scouting data, lodging, meals, and access to prime terrain. They work with hunters of different ability levels and customize trips for specific goals—whether you want to spend nights deep in wilderness or hunt from a comfortable lodge base.
